Roger G Little, Chairman and CEO, stated, "The solar industry continued to experience a severe slowdown in manufacturing expansion driven by sustained worldwide overcapacity. Although we are seeing evidence of some growth in PV systems on a global basis, this continued oversupply and imbalance of PV modules as it relates to market demand has resulted in a dramatic reduction in demand for PV manufacturing equipment, which is expected to continue until the module supply/demand disparity is resolved. As a result, there is virtually no expansion of current module manufacturers to absorb existing equipment in inventory. In addition, we are seeing many module manufacturers going out of business, resulting in a flood of used equipment on the market. The Company has developed and continues to implement significant cost reduction efforts, and is looking at opportunities to expand revenue in other solar markets, and to identify potential strategic alternatives that could mitigate the decline in revenue as a result of global economic conditions."
